Preheat the oven to 400F. Spray a baking sheet with oil.
Gently remove the stems, scoop out the gills and spray the tops of the mushrooms with oil, season with 1/8 tsp salt and fresh pepper.
Heat a large nonstick saute pan over medium heat, add oil, onion, garlic and red pepper and season with 1/8 tsp salt. Cook until soft, 3 to 4 minutes. Add the baby spinach and saute until wilted, about 1 minute.
In a medium bowl add the ricotta, parmesan cheese and egg, mix well.
Add the cooked vegetables and basil and mix.
Stuff the mushrooms with ricotta mixture and top each with 2 tbsp marinara, 2 tbsp mozzarella.
Bake in the oven for 20 to 25 minutes. Garnish with basil and enjoy!
